Carpe Diem Meaning Latin . What is the meaning of carpe diem? Carpe diem is a latin phrase that is popularly translated as seize the day, meaning to make the most of each moment of your life or live life to the fullest. ‘carpe diem’ is usually translated from the latin as ‘seize the day’. Carpe diem is a latin term that translates to seize the day or pluck the day. it is a phrase often used to encourage people to make the most of the present moment and to enjoy life to the.
